Japanese studio Nendo designed a collection of boat shoes for iconic Italian footwear and bag brand Tod’s. Nendo combines two materials for the shoes’s upper – a soft leather for the vamp, and suede for the quarter and backstay – and visually connected the two materials with side detail like an envelope’s string tie.
A rubber sole like those traditionally used for deck shoes emphasises the Tod’s design lineage, and carefully hidden, near-invisible stitching bring out the softness of the shoes while inside, a highly breathable mesh inner gives lightness and a sense of relaxation.
